Understanding the Recent Clinical Analysis
A ground-breaking observational study recently published in the journal Anticancer Research has caught the attention of the medical community. Researchers, including Dr. Peter McCullough, investigated the effects of a compounded formulation of Ivermectin and Mebendazole on 197 patients dealing with various cancer diagnoses. The results revealed that 84.4% of those who reached the six-month follow-up mark experienced a clinical benefit, ranging from tumor shrinkage to disease stabilization.
The rationale behind this combination is rooted in the unique way these two agents interact with abnormal cell growth. Ivermectin is believed to interfere with the pathways that tumors use to proliferate while encouraging programmed cell death. Simultaneously, Mebendazole works by limiting the glucose supply that cancer cells require to survive and spread. Because both compounds are already well-understood and have high safety profiles, researchers are calling for more rigorous, large-scale clinical trials to further validate these initial, promising findings.

Navigating the Canadian Supplement Landscape
For Canadians looking to incorporate supplements into their daily routine, it is crucial to ensure you are purchasing products that meet local safety standards. Always look for a Natural Product Number (NPN) on the label, which indicates that Health Canada has reviewed the product for safety, quality, and efficacy.
- Check for the NPN – An eight-digit number displayed on the label confirms the product is authorized for sale in Canada.
- Source from Reputable Retailers – Buy from established Canadian retailers that adhere to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P).
- Consult a Professional – Before starting any new regimen, discuss your health goals with a licensed naturopathic doctor or family physician to ensure the supplements are appropriate for your specific needs.
